As an ARMHS provider, we offer mental health rehabilitation services that honor and respect religious beliefs and cultural diversity. Our goal is to assist clients in adapting and integrating into their communities. We achieve this by connecting them with local resources, supporting their employment opportunities, enhancing family relationships, and facilitating access to educational opportunities

What basic living and social skills do our ARMHS workers teach?

  • Managing the symptoms of mental illness
  • Managing a household
  • Planning for employment
  • Pursuing education
  • Re-entering community living after treatment.
  • Communicating opinions, thoughts, feelings, or key information with others
  • Discovering and using community resources to get needs met.
  • Getting outside help to deal with a difficult situation.
  • Preventing relapse
  • Budgeting and shopping
  • Developing a healthy lifestyle
  • Learning to get around the community.
  • Monitoring use and effectiveness of medications

Who Qualifies for ARMHS?

  • Adults 18 years and older
  • Live in Hennepin, Ramsey or Dakota Counties.
  • Diagnosed with mental illness for which adult rehabilitative mental health services are determined to be medically necessary by a qualified mental health professional.
